43 - The Importance of Organizations in Your D&D Campaign

Summary:
Byron & Sean discuss the importance of organizations within TTRPG campaigns, such as guilds, merchant associations, and churches. Organizations add depth and context to the campaign world, shaping its history, politics, and culture. They should be integrated into the narrative and have a purpose that aligns with the players' goals. Creating connections between player characters and organizations increases player engagement. Tips on introducing organizations gradually and subtly are provided, using narrative integration, character ties, and in-game benefits. Secrets and intrigue within organizations add depth and reward exploration. Combat should be the last resort, with a focus on influence and maneuvering.


Key Takeaways:

  • Organizations are essential for creating a multifaceted and immersive campaign world.
  • Organizations shape the world's history, politics, and culture and provide context for the players' adventures.
  • Narrative integration, character ties, and in-game benefits can encourage player engagement with organizations.
  • Secrets and intrigue within organizations add depth and reward exploration.
  • Conflict should be the last resort, and organizations should focus on influence and maneuvering before resorting to combat.
